Key Considerations for HVAC Installation
Before investing in a new HVAC system, consider these crucial factors:
• Proper sizing for your space
• Energy efficiency ratings
• Installation location optimization
• Ductwork condition and design
• Zoning requirements
Maximizing Your Air Conditioning Investment
To get the most from your air conditioning installation:
1. Schedule regular maintenance checks
2. Replace filters monthly
3. Keep outdoor units clear of debris
4. Monitor thermostat settings
5. Consider smart technology integration

Energy Efficiency Tips
Beyond installation, maximize efficiency by:
• Installing programmable thermostats
• Sealing air leaks around windows and doors
• Adding proper insulation
• Maintaining regular service schedules
• Using ceiling fans to supplement air flow
